Best Pet Duck Breeds for Beginners

For those new to keeping ducks as pets, it’s important to choose a breed that is easy to care for and has a friendly disposition. One excellent choice for beginners is the Pekin duck. Pekins are known for their calm and gentle nature, making them great companions for novice duck owners. They are also excellent egg layers, making them a practical choice for those interested in both pets and egg production. Another beginner-friendly breed is the Khaki Campbell. These ducks are highly productive layers, often producing over 300 eggs per year. They are also known for their friendly and sociable personalities, making them a joy to have around. Both Pekin and Khaki Campbell ducks are relatively low-maintenance and adaptable, making them ideal choices for those new to duck ownership.

Best Pet Duck Breeds for Small Backyards

For those with limited outdoor space, it’s important to choose a pet duck breed that is well-suited for smaller backyards. One excellent choice for small spaces is the Call duck. These ducks are one of the smallest domestic duck breeds, making them ideal for compact yards or urban settings. Call ducks are also known for their friendly and sociable nature, making them great pets for those living in close quarters. Another suitable breed for small backyards is the Swedish Blue duck. These ducks are relatively small in size and are known for their calm and gentle temperament, making them well-suited for confined spaces. By choosing breeds like Call ducks and Swedish Blue ducks, individuals with limited outdoor space can still enjoy the pleasures of keeping pet ducks.

Best Pet Duck Breeds for Egg Production

For those interested in keeping ducks for egg production, there are several breeds that stand out for their exceptional laying abilities. One top choice for egg production is the Khaki Campbell duck. These ducks are prolific layers, often producing over 300 eggs per year. They are also known for their hardiness and adaptability, making them well-suited for various climates and environments. Another excellent breed for egg production is the Welsh Harlequin duck. These ducks are known for their high egg production as well as their calm and friendly nature, making them a practical and enjoyable choice for those interested in both eggs and companionship. By selecting breeds like Khaki Campbells and Welsh Harlequins, individuals can enjoy a bountiful supply of fresh eggs while also experiencing the joys of keeping pet ducks.

What are the characteristics of the Khaki Campbell duck?

The Khaki Campbell duck is known for its excellent egg-laying abilities, friendly temperament, and hardy nature. They are also good foragers and do well in free-range environments.

What are the characteristics of the Indian Runner duck?

Indian Runner ducks are known for their upright posture and excellent egg-laying abilities. They are also active and curious, making them entertaining pets to have around.

What are the characteristics of the Call duck?

Call ducks are small, friendly, and have a distinctive “call” that gives them their name. They are good foragers and do well in both free-range and confined environments.

What are the characteristics of the Pekin duck?

Pekin ducks are known for their docile nature, large size, and excellent meat production. They are also good egg layers and make great pets for families.
